Le marché du jeu en ligne évolue à la vitesse d’un tour de roulette : chaque milliseconde compte lorsqu’un joueur décide de placer une mise. Le défi majeur auquel les opérateurs sont confrontés aujourd’hui est d’offrir des jeux fluides, quel que soit le terminal – smartphone, tablette ou ordinateur de bureau. La rapidité d’affichage influe directement sur le taux de conversion : une page qui met plus de trois secondes à charger décourage près de 40 % des visiteurs, tandis qu’une expérience instantanée augmente la rétention de 25 % en moyenne.
Dans ce contexte, le meilleur casino en ligne devient plus qu’une promesse marketing ; il s’agit d’un critère de sélection pour les joueurs qui comparent les temps de chargement, la fluidité des animations et la disponibilité des bonus. Le site Bakchich propose une sélection neutre d’établissements où la performance est prise en compte, sans prétendre établir de classement officiel.
Cet article décortique les leviers techniques qui permettent d’atteindre des temps de réponse quasi‑instantanés. Nous aborderons d’abord l’architecture serveur et les réseaux de distribution, puis la compression et le streaming des assets graphiques, l’optimisation du code client, les choix entre applications natives et hybrides, les tests de performance continus, et enfin la sécurité sans compromis. Chaque partie s’appuie sur des exemples concrets et des chiffres issus de déploiements réels afin de fournir aux décideurs du secteur une feuille de route exploitable.
1. Architecture serveur & réseaux de distribution – 380 mots
Les plateformes de casino modernes se construisent généralement autour de deux grands paradigmes : l’architecture monolithique, héritée des premiers sites de jeu, et l’architecture micro‑services, qui découple chaque fonction (gestion des comptes, moteur de jeu, paiement) en services indépendants.
| Architecture | Avantages | Inconvénients |
|---|---|---|
| Monolithique | Déploiement simple, moins de latence interne | Difficulté de mise à l’échelle, risque de panne globale |
| Micro‑services | Scalabilité horizontale, résilience, mise à jour indépendante | Complexité de l’orchestration, surcharge réseau interne |
Les opérateurs qui ont migré vers les micro‑services constatent une réduction de 20 % du temps moyen de réponse (TTR) grâce à la mise en place de conteneurs Docker orchestrés par Kubernetes. Cette virtualisation permet de placer les services de jeu les plus gourmands (génération de nombres aléatoires, rendu 3D) sur des nœuds dédiés, alors que les fonctions de support (FAQ, chat) s’exécutent sur des instances plus légères.
Le réseau de distribution joue un rôle tout aussi crucial. Un CDN (Content Delivery Network) copie les assets statiques – sprites, sons, vidéos promotionnelles – sur des points de présence (PoP) situés à proximité des utilisateurs mobiles. Avant l’intégration d’un CDN, la latence moyenne mesurée depuis Paris vers le serveur principal était de 120 ms. Après le déploiement d’un CDN européen, cette latence est tombée à 45 ms, soit une amélioration de 62 %.
Pour les joueurs de casino en ligne France, où la connexion mobile reste souvent 4G, ces gains se traduisent par un affichage du tableau de bord de compte en moins d’une seconde et un démarrage de jeu de slots comme Starburst en 800 ms au lieu de 2 s.
2. Compression & streaming des assets graphiques – 340 mots
Les graphismes des machines à sous modernes utilisent des textures haute résolution et des animations vidéo qui peuvent rapidement alourdir le chargement. Le passage des formats JPEG/PNG aux standards WebP et AVIF réduit la taille des images de 30 à 50 % sans perte de qualité perceptible sur les écrans de 5 à 6 pouces.
En parallèle, les vidéos de bonus (démo de jackpot, tutoriels) migrent vers le codec H.265, qui offre le même débit visuel que le H.264 avec une réduction d’environ 40 %. Sur le Jackpot Giant, la bande passante consommée passe de 3,2 Mo à 1,9 Mo pour un clip de 30 secondes, ce qui se révèle décisif pour les joueurs en roaming.
Le “lazy‑loading” s’applique dès que le joueur ouvre la page d’un nouveau jeu : les assets visibles sont chargés immédiatement, tandis que les éléments hors‑écran (tableaux de gains, arrière‑plans secondaires) sont récupérés uniquement au moment du scroll. Cette technique, combinée au streaming adaptatif MPEG‑DASH ou HLS, ajuste la résolution vidéo en fonction du débit réel du réseau. Un joueur sur une connexion 3G verra le même slot, mais avec des textures compressées à 720p au lieu de 1080p, préservant ainsi le First Paint sous les 1,2 s.
Le bénéfice sur la consommation de données est palpable : un session de 30 minutes sur un jeu de table en live consomme en moyenne 45 Mo au lieu de 78 Mo, ce qui allège la facture mobile et encourage la fidélité.
3. Optimisation du code client (HTML5/JavaScript) – 300 mots
Le front‑end des casinos en ligne repose aujourd’hui sur HTML5 et JavaScript moderne. L’utilisation d’ES6 modules permet de charger uniquement les parties du code réellement nécessaires à chaque jeu. Le “tree‑shaking” élimine les fonctions inutilisées pendant la phase de bundling, tandis que la minification réduit la taille du fichier JavaScript de 1,8 Mo à 650 Ko.
Les calculs intensifs – génération de RNG, physique des rouleaux, animations CSS – sont délégués aux Web‑Workers. Ainsi, le thread principal reste libre pour répondre aux interactions tactiles, ce qui diminue le Time to Interactive (TTI) de 2,3 s à 1,1 s sur un smartphone Android.
Le cache côté navigateur est géré grâce aux Service Workers. Une stratégie “Cache‑First” pour les assets immuables (icônes, polices) garantit leur disponibilité même en mode offline, tandis que les requêtes dynamiques (solde du joueur, état des bonus) utilisent un modèle “Network‑First” avec fallback sur le cache en cas de perte de connexion.
Exemple de configuration Service Worker
- Pré‑cacher :
/assets/*.webp,/fonts/*.woff2 - Runtime :
fetch→networkFirstpour/api/balance - Nettoyage : supprimer les caches expirés tous les 30 jours
Cette approche minimise les aller‑retours serveur et assure que le joueur voit toujours la première image du jeu en moins de 500 ms, même sur un réseau 4G marginal.
4. Intégration native vs hybride sur mobile – 350 mots
Les opérateurs hésitent souvent entre développer une application native (iOS / Android) ou opter pour une solution hybride (React Native, Flutter, PWA).
Performances
- Native : accès direct aux GPU, temps de lancement moyen de 0,8 s pour Mega Moolah.
- Hybride : couche JavaScript supplémentaire, lancement autour de 1,4 s.
Les plateformes qui ont migré d’une PWA vers une application native ont enregistré une réduction de 30 % du temps de lancement et une amélioration de 15 % du FPS pendant les bonus interactifs.
Progressive Web Apps (PWA)
Les PWA offrent toutefois des atouts uniques : aucune installation via les stores, mise à jour instantanée, notifications push pour les offres de retrait instantané, et un mode “offline” limité aux préférences du compte. Un joueur français qui visite le site via une PWA peut ajouter l’icône à son écran d’accueil en deux clics, puis accéder au tableau de bord en 0,9 s, comparable à une application native légère.
Tableau comparatif
| Critère | Application native | Hybride (React Native/Flutter) | PWA |
|---|---|---|---|
| Temps de lancement | 0,8 s | 1,4 s | 0,9 s (installe) |
| Accès aux capteurs biométriques | Oui (Touch ID, Face ID) | Oui (via plugins) | Limité (WebAuthn) |
| Distribution | Stores (App Store, Google Play) | Stores ou direct | Direct via URL |
| Maintenance | Versions séparées | Code partagé, mais dépendances natives | Unique code base |
En pratique, de nombreux casinos adoptent une stratégie “dual‑track” : une PWA pour attirer les nouveaux joueurs et une application native pour les gros parieurs qui exigent la meilleure réactivité possible, notamment lorsqu’ils poursuivent des jackpots progressifs de plusieurs millions d’euros.
5. Tests de performance et monitoring continu – 340 mots
Pour garantir que les temps de chargement restent dans les limites souhaitées, les équipes techniques intègrent des outils de mesure dès le processus de développement. Lighthouse fournit un score global de performance, tandis que WebPageTest permet d’analyser le comportement sous différents réseaux (3G, 4G, fibre).
Les métriques clés surveillées sont :
- TTFB (Time to First Byte) : idéalement < 200 ms grâce à un CDN performant.
- FCP (First Contentful Paint) : < 1,0 s sur mobile.
- LCP (Largest Contentful Paint) : < 2,5 s pour les pages de bonus.
- CLS (Cumulative Layout Shift) : < 0,1 pour éviter les déplacements d’éléments pendant le jeu.
- Time to Interactive : < 1,5 s pour les slots à haute volatilité.
Un pipeline CI/CD automatisé exécute ces tests à chaque merge. Si un build dépasse les seuils définis (par exemple FCP > 1,2 s), le déploiement est bloqué et le développeur reçoit un rapport détaillé.
Le monitoring en production s’appuie sur des solutions APM comme New Relic ou Datadog. Des alertes sont configurées pour déclencher une notification Slack dès que le TTFB dépasse 250 ms ou que le taux d’erreurs HTTP 5xx grimpe au‑delà de 0,5 %. Cette réactivité permet de corriger un problème de surcharge de serveur en moins de 15 minutes, évitant ainsi la perte de mises potentielles.
6. Sécurité & conformité sans sacrifier la rapidité – 350 mots
La sécurité est un pilier incontournable du jeu en ligne, mais elle ne doit pas alourdir la latence. Le protocole TLS 1.3, déployé par la majorité des top casino en ligne, réduit le nombre de round‑trips nécessaires à l’établissement d’une connexion sécurisée, ce qui fait passer le temps de handshake de 150 ms à moins de 30 ms.
L’authentification forte se combine désormais à la rapidité d’accès : les joueurs peuvent activer le 2FA via une application d’authentification ou la biométrie (empreinte digitale, reconnaissance faciale). Ces étapes s’exécutent en parallèle du chargement du tableau de bord grâce aux Web‑Workers, de sorte que le délai perçu reste inférieur à une seconde.
Les exigences réglementaires – licences d’eGaming, conformité GDPR – imposent des contrôles de localisation des données et des audits réguliers. En adoptant une architecture à micro‑services, les opérateurs peuvent isoler les modules de traitement des données personnelles sur des serveurs dédiés, tout en conservant un accès ultra‑rapide aux services de jeu.
Par ailleurs, les plateformes qui utilisent des bases de données en mémoire (Redis) pour les sessions utilisateur constatent une réduction du temps de réponse de 40 % lors des pics de trafic, tout en respectant les standards de chiffrement au repos.
Enfin, le site Bakchich, en tant que ressource d’information, recense les meilleures pratiques de conformité et les liens vers les autorités de régulation, offrant aux opérateurs un point de référence neutre pour aligner sécurité et performance.
Conclusion – 180 mots
La vitesse d’une plateforme de casino en ligne n’est plus un avantage concurrentiel, c’est une condition sine qua non pour satisfaire les joueurs exigeants du marché français et international. En associant une architecture micro‑services optimisée, des CDN efficaces, une compression d’assets de pointe, un code client allégé et des stratégies mobiles adaptées, les opérateurs obtiennent des temps de chargement inférieurs à une seconde, même sur des connexions 4G.
Cette performance s’accompagne d’une sécurité robuste – TLS 1.3, authentification forte, conformité GDPR – qui ne ralentit pas l’expérience utilisateur. Les tendances à l’horizon – edge computing pour pré‑traiter les requêtes à la périphérie du réseau, IA qui prédit les assets à charger en fonction du comportement du joueur, et réalité augmentée intégrée aux jeux mobiles – promettent de pousser encore plus loin les limites de la rapidité.
Les opérateurs qui embrassent ces innovations offrent non seulement un divertissement fluide, mais également la confiance nécessaire pour encourager le retrait instantané et la fidélisation à long terme. Pour rester à la pointe, il suffit de consulter des ressources fiables comme Bakchich, qui répertorie les évolutions techniques et les exigences réglementaires du secteur.